The Cloffice
We only have one bedroom downstairs that has been serving as a guest room for a few years.
Now that I’m working from home and needed a space to set up a workstation, that room seemed like the perfect candidate.
There is, however, no room for a queen bed, shelving, and a desk in there.
That’s when we had the idea for the “cloffice.”
We saw a few ideas on Pinterest on how to set up an office in a closet. And we loved it!
So this has been my little project for the last few days: to convert a closet into a mini office.
This week I had an electrician come and install three double outlets so I can have power in there:
Sometime in the next few days I will receive a desk and chair that I purchased recently. They will go in there, and then I’ll be good to go.
